U.S. patent number D300,323 [Application Number 07/123,578] was granted by the patent office on 1989-03-21 for disc drive assembly.
This patent grant is currently assigned to Teac Corporation. Invention is credited to Yasushi Noda, Yoshiaki Sakai, Kenji Takeuchi.

Description
FIG. 1 is a front elevational view of a disc drive assembly showing
our new design;
FIG. 2 is a top plan view thereof;
FIG. 3 is a left side elevational view thereof;
FIG. 4 is a bottom plan view thereof;
FIG. 5 is a rear elevational view thereof;
FIG. 6 is a front perspective view thereof, the eject button panel
in the bottom cut-out of the disc drive door being recessed back
into the drive, this being the normal position of the eject button
when there is no disc in the disc drive; and
FIG. 7 is a front perspective view thereof with a magnetic disc
being shown in broken lines for illustrative purposes inside of the
disc drive, and with the eject button panel moved forward so that
it is flush with the surface of the front panel, this being the
normal position of the eject panel when a magnetic disc is inserted
into the disc drive.
